Equine EPO (Erythropoietin) ELISA Kit
The Equine (EPO) Erythropoietin ELISA Kit measures Erythropoietin in Equine samples. The plate has been pre-coated with Equine EPO antibody. EPO present in the sample is added and binds to antibodies coated on the wells. And then biotinylated Equine EPO Antibody is added and binds to EPO in the sample. Then Streptavidin-HRP is added and binds to the Biotinylated EPO antibody. After incubation unbound Streptavidin-HRP is washed away during a washing step. Substrate solution is then added and color develops in proportion to the amount of Equine EPO. The reaction is terminated by addition of acidic stop solution and absorbance is measured at 450 nm.

Background
Hormone involved in the regulation of erythrocyte proliferation and differentiation and the maintenance of a physiological level of circulating erythrocyte mass. Binds to EPOR leading to EPOR dimerization and JAK2 activation thereby activating specific downstream effectors, including STAT1 and STAT3. Source: UniProt Consortium (2025)
